英文摘要The larvae of the diseased intestinal pathogenic bacterium Urechis unicinctus(3000 to 4000 kg) were isolated and identified, and their growth characteristics and drug sensitivities were evaluated to provide a treatment basis for diseases that occur in an artificial culture of the larva. Isolation and purification, biochemical identification, 16 S rRNA gene sequence analysis, artificial resumption infection, and growth curve assay as well as studies on optimum growth temperature, pH, and salt content were conducted on the pathogenic bacteria isolated from human intestines. The K–B disk diffusion method was applied for drug sensitivity testing, whereas ofloxacin was used for security detection testing. For pathogenic Vibrio, the optimum growth temperature, pH, and salt content were 30℃, 6.0, and 35, respectively. Drug sensitivity tests demonstrated that Vibrio is highly sensitive to chloramphenicol, carbenicillin, ofloxacin, and ceftriaxone; moderately sensitive to minocycline, gentamicin, kanamycin, cefazolin, and tetracycline; but resistant to azithromycin, neomycin, vancomycin, rifampicin, erythromycin, clindamycin, and amoxicillin. Security detection tests revealed that although ofloxacin exerted a clear antibacterial effect, it did not harm U. unicinctus. Based on the results of the drug sensitivity test, Vibrio-infected U. unicinctus can be effectively treated using targeted antibiotics. These experimental results could provide a theoretical basis and treatment pattern for the prevention and treatment of U. unicinctus in artificial cultures.
